Ankle foot orthoses (AFOs) are removable splints or braces that support the feet, ankles and lower leg of children with cerebral palsy. They may help children with everyday skills like walking, running, jumping and climbing stairs. Ankle foot orthoses are also used to reduce pain and prevent deformity of the foot and ...

The help they have given her … Web15 aug. 2014 · Cerebral palsy is the term for a group of brain disorders that affect muscles and body movement. The condition is caused by damage to parts of the brain that control muscle movement, balance, and posture. Signs and symptoms of cerebral palsy usually appear in infancy or early childhood and last throughout a person's life.
